    Let M be a Kähler manifold and let \({\mathbb{C}}Q_ c\) be a complex space form with holomorphic sectional curvature c. The problem of the present paper is to find conditions which imply that a minimal isometric immersion f of M into \({\mathbb{C}}Q_ c\) is holomorphic. The authors give a complete answer to the problem in the case \(c<0:\) If \(\dim_{{\mathbb{C}}} M>1\), then f is holomorphic or antiholomorphic, if \(\dim_{{\mathbb{C}}} M=1\), then there are examples of minimal immersions which are not holomorphic. It is not enough to restrict the dimension of M if \(c>0\), but if f is a circular immersion a similar theorem holds for positively curved complex space forms.
